The Vampire Files, Volume Three Two Jack Fleming, Vampire P.I., novels—now in one volume. Chicago is a rough town, even for the undead. But someone has to clean up the dirty burg, and Jack Flemming is just the vampire for the job. The Vampire Files, Volume Three includes two adventures featuring Chicago’s very own vampire P.I. as he cleans up the streets, one crook at a time.
A Chill in the Blood (originally published
June 1998 in hardcover and June 1999 in mass market
paperback) Caught between the local hoods and the boys from New York, Jack has to stop the battle before it starts. But how much of his remaining humanity will be have to give up to do it?
The Dark Sleep (originally published June
1999 in hardcover and May 2000 in mass market
paperback) Before he can resolve this situation, Jack is hired to retrieve incriminating letters form the ex-lover of a young socialite. A smpe job—until bullets start flying and Jack’s mortal partner get caught in the cross fire. Someone’s after Jack. But who? Jack is willing to risk his life to find the truth—after all, he’s already dead. Only this time, it’s not his life he’s risking...
